What is an Orangery?
An Orangery Project Contractors is a glass-enclosed structure typically attached to your house. Unlike a conservatory, which is mainly made of glass, an orangery incorporates more considerable products, such as brick or stone, to attain an elegant and strong aesthetic. Orangeries function as a best mix of outside and indoor living, making them a beneficial alternative for property owners wanting to create a flexible space.

Final InspectionConduct a walkthrough with the professional, ensuring that everything fulfills expectations.Deal with any concerns or issues before task sign-off.FAQs About Hiring Orangery Project ContractorsQ1: How long does it require to develop an orangery?
A1: The timeline can vary based upon the intricacy of the style and contractor performance. Usually, a job can take anywhere from 8 to 16 weeks.
Q2: What is the average expense of constructing an orangery?
A2: Costs differ extensively depending on elements such as size, products, and area. A typical variety is in between ₤ 15,000 to ₤ 50,000.
Q3: Do I need planning approval for an orangery?
A3: In the majority of cases, orangeries fall under allowed advancement, however it is important to inspect regional regulations, as some areas may require planning consent.
Q4: How can I optimize natural light in my orangery?
A4: Incorporating big glass panels, skylights, and light-colored materials can considerably boost natural illumination.
Q5: What maintenance should I anticipate?
A5: Regular examine seals, cleaning up glass surfaces, and examining for wear on frames will assist preserve the orangery's appearance and performance.
